About The Role
As a Junior IT Support Engineer, you'll be the first point of contact for technical support across the organisation. You'll provide assistance, troubleshoot hardware and software issues, manage user accounts and access, and help ensure smooth operation of our devices, applications and core IT services. You'll also assist with system checks, documentation, and occasional IT projects.
Service Desk & User Support
* Provide first-level support, logging and prioritising tickets across phone, email, and in person.
* Troubleshoot common Windows/M365, hardware, and network issues, escalating when required.
End User Device Management
* Deploy, configure and maintain laptops, desktops, mobiles and tablets.
* Perform basic hardware fixes and maintain accurate asset records.
Accounts, Access & Security
* Create and manage user accounts and access across AD/Entra ID and M365.
* Support password resets, MFA setup and general security practices.
Systems & Administration Support
* Assist with routine system checks, software installs and licence management.
* Support meeting room technology and AV setups.
Documentation & Continuous Improvement
* Maintain accurate ticketing records and update IT documentation.
* Identify recurring issues and contribute to process improvements.
Other Responsibilities
* Assist with IT projects, office moves and general IT tasks as required.
What We're Looking For
* 1–2 years' IT support experience, with solid troubleshooting skills and knowledge of Windows, M365, AD/Entra ID and basic networking.
* Strong communication, customer service and organisational skills, with a willingness to learn and grow.
* Experience with ticketing systems, Intune/MDM, remote support tools or ITIL practices is a bonus.
* IT-related qualification (or equivalent experience), with Microsoft Fundamentals/ITIL Foundation desirable.
* Friendly, reliable team player who is detail-oriented and handles confidential information appropriately.
